UNF’s CGEP hosts discussion on how to ‘Build your Career and Network in Jacksonville'

The University of North Florida’s Coggin Graduate and Executive Programs (CGEP) is hosting a networking event for its graduate students on Aug. 19 featuring a panel discussion on how to ‘Build your Career and Network in Jacksonville.’

The panel discussion will be led by top leaders across industries in Jacksonville. The event will also celebrate UNF’s return to campus and an opportunity to network with Coggin graduate students, faculty and alumni.

The event is sponsored by Crowley, a leading logistics, marine and energy solutions company with its global headquarters in Jacksonville. Crowley is one of many local Jacksonville companies that CGEP has developed a relationship with in their efforts to provide local companies with highly skilled, well-rounded graduate students.

UNF’s CGEP is committed to navigating the ever-evolving landscape of the business world to help meet the needs of local Jacksonville companies. The CGEP alumni network spans globally and has a strong presence locally, fostering opportunities to connect with students, alumni and potential employers.

The event will be held at the Coggin Graduate and Executive Program’s downtown location at 112 West Adams St, 4th floor, on Thursday, Aug. 19 from 5:30 to 7:30 p.m.
